RIVERSIDE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L
RIVERSIDE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is a Title I public elementary school that is part of the JACKSON school district, located in MARIANNA, FL with about 659 students offering grade levels from 3rd Grade to 5th Grade. Student demographics can be found below. A Title I school provides supplemental financial assistance to school districts for children from low-income families. Its purpose is to provide all children significant opportunity to receive a fair, equitable, and high-quality education. With about 44 teachers, RIVERSIDE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L has a student/teacher ratio of about 14:1. The national average for public schools is about 15:1. A lower student/teacher ratio is a key factor that determines how much a teacher can devote his/her time to each individual student thus improving, or reducing (in the event of a higher student/teacher ratio) the attention each student is given for their educational needs.
